Weight Capacity Considerations

Choosing a zero gravity chair for chronic back pain means paying close attention to its weight capacity, as this factor directly impacts safety and comfort. Most chairs support between 300 to 500 pounds, so you’ll want to verify the chair matches your body weight. A higher weight capacity often indicates a sturdier frame, reducing wobbling and enhancing durability, which is vital for back support. Many chairs are designed with reinforced materials for those needing extra support, alleviating pressure points on your back. Selecting a chair that fits your weight confirms you maximize the ergonomic benefits of the zero gravity position, ultimately aiding in your relief from chronic back pain. Ergonomic Design Benefits

Although you might not realize it, the ergonomic design of a zero gravity chair plays an essential role in managing chronic back pain. This design promotes proper spinal alignment, relieving pressure on your lower back. With adjustable headrests and lumbar support, you can tailor the chair to your specific needs for enhanced comfort during extended use. The zero gravity position elevates your legs above your heart, improving circulation and reducing tension in your back and joints. Additionally, breathable materials and cushioning distribute your weight evenly, minimizing discomfort and preventing painful pressure points. The ability to recline and adjust angles further allows you to find your best position, helping alleviate muscle strain and promote healing for chronic back conditions.

Reclining Mechanism Features

Selecting the right reclining mechanism is vital for effectively managing chronic back pain with a zero gravity chair. Look for models that offer adjustable angles, ideally between 90° and 170°, to find the perfect position that reduces pressure on your spine. A secure locking mechanism is important; features like deep grooves or aluminum alloy locks guarantee you won’t accidentally shift while reclining. Chairs providing a true zero gravity position elevate your legs above heart level, greatly easing spinal compression. Ergonomic designs that support your spine’s natural curvature can further alleviate discomfort. Additionally, consider models with dual elastic cords or bungee systems, as they enhance weight distribution and comfort, accommodating various body types and sizes effectively.

Material Durability Importance

When managing chronic back pain, the durability of your zero gravity chair’s materials plays a significant role in ensuring long-term comfort and support. Look for chairs that can support between 300 to 500 pounds, as their strong construction reflects reliability. High-quality fabrics like upgraded texlin or breathable mesh offer longevity while minimizing wear. A sturdy frame made from thick steel tubing or aluminum alloy provides essential stability, vital for your needs. Additionally, chairs designed with double elastic cords enhance weight distribution and ergonomic support, alleviating pressure on your back. Finally, regular maintenance, such as cleaning and checking for wear, can extend your chair’s lifespan, helping you achieve lasting relief.
